Demographics
Canyon Crest Elementary School is one of tthirty elementary schools in the Fontana Unified School District. It is an early-start, traditional school serving approximately 550 students in preschool through fifth grade. Our student population is comprised of approximately 82.7% Hispanic/Latino, 7.6% African American, 5.2% White, 2.5% Asian, and 2% other ethnicities.
